Stunning Beach & Pools
Guests consistently rave about the beautiful, soft white sand beach and the inviting, well-maintained swimming pools, forming the core of the resort's appeal.
Friendly & Attentive Staff
The resort's staff often receive high praise for their friendly demeanor and attentive service, contributing significantly to a positive guest experience.
Excellent Value
Many visitors consider the Occidental Caribe to offer outstanding value for the price, particularly considering the comprehensive all-inclusive package.
Exceptional Cleanliness
The resort is widely commended for its commitment to cleanliness, with guests frequently highlighting the well-maintained grounds and spotless rooms.
Engaging Entertainment
The varied and lively entertainment program, including unique aerial classes, is a recurring positive theme, keeping guests entertained throughout their stay.
A La Carte Restaurant Access
A significant recurring concern is the difficulty in securing reservations for the specialty a la carte restaurants, often leading guests to rely on the buffet.
Buffet Dining Consistency
While specialty dining can be good, the buffet receives mixed reviews, with some guests finding the food bland, repetitive, or inconsistent in quality.
Weekend Crowding & Noise
The resort can become very crowded and noisy on weekends due to day passes sold to local residents and students, impacting the overall atmosphere.
Dated Room Decor & Maintenance
Although rooms are clean, their decor is often described as dated, and some guests report issues with inconsistent air conditioning or mini-fridge bugs.

The trapeze. That's the specific thing. Occidental Caribe maintains a dedicated aerial circus area where guests can take actual trapeze classes — an activity you will not find at most Punta Cana all-inclusives. Combined with a resort self-described as a 'party atmosphere,' this property draws an active, social crowd that skews young-adult and group travelers.
The Mediterranean castle architecture is unusual for Punta Cana's generally Caribbean-tropical look. The sprawling 798-room property sits on Arena Gorda Beach (also called Bávaro Beach), one of the prettier stretches in the area. The resort holds both the Bandera Azul (Blue Flag) ecological certification and Green Globe certification, which reflects genuine environmental commitments beyond marketing.
The honest assessment: this is a lively, high-volume resort. The pool area runs entertainment from morning into evening, bars stay active late, and the guest mix trends toward groups and couples in their 20s and 30s looking for an energetic vacation. Families with young children are technically accommodated, but the atmosphere is not oriented around them. Guests who want quiet evenings should look at other properties.
Practical numbers: 798 rooms, 8 restaurants (including 7 specialty à la carte), 7–10 bars, approximately 29 km from Punta Cana International Airport (PUJ), a 20–30 minute drive. Last renovated in 2007, which means some rooms and facilities show age. The circus program, regular theme nights, and strong entertainment schedule are the differentiators that justify choosing this over quieter Bávaro options.
